AIAI Summary
ECVT has become a narrower sulfur-solutions turnaround with real Q2 profitability improvement, but thin free cash flow, rising leverage, and a broken stock trend mean investors should treat the earnings rebound as unproven until it converts into durable cash generation and the shares reclaim key technical levels.
